Industrial Building Painting in Fort Collins, CO
Industrial building painting services encompass the application of durable, high-quality coatings to large-scale commercial and industrial structures, including warehouses, factories, and manufacturing facilities. These projects often involve extensive surface preparation and specialized equipment to ensure even coverage and long-lasting results. Property owners typically seek these services to improve the appearance of their buildings, protect surfaces from weather and wear, or comply with safety and branding standards. It’s important to understand the scope of the project, the types of surfaces involved, and any specific requirements related to the building’s use before requesting industrial painting.
Before requesting industrial building painting, property owners should consider factors such as the size and complexity of the project, the types of materials being painted, and any necessary surface repairs or treatments. Clarifying expectations about surface preparation, the type of coatings used, and the desired finish can help ensure the results meet the property’s needs. Additionally, understanding the potential impact on daily operations and coordinating schedules accordingly can facilitate a smoother process. Proper planning and clear communication are essential for achieving a successful and long-lasting paint job on large-scale industrial structures.

Industrial Building Painting Questions
What types of industrial buildings can be painted? Industrial building painting services typically cover warehouses, factories, storage facilities, and manufacturing plants to improve appearance and protect surfaces.
Why is surface preparation important before painting? Proper surface preparation ensures paint adhesion, extends durability, and results in a smooth, professional finish on industrial structures.
What finishes are available for industrial building painting? Various finishes such as matte, gloss, or satin are available to meet specific functional and aesthetic needs of industrial properties.
How often should industrial building exteriors be repainted? Repainting frequency depends on exposure and material, but generally, exterior surfaces should be inspected every few years for maintenance needs.
